Caroline Stills loves to write books for children. She lives in a
historic cottage in Australia, surrounded by trees and gardens,
much like the one in The House of 12 Bunnies, which she cowrote
with her ten-year-old daughter, Sarcia. Her website is
www.carolinestills.com.
Judith Rossell is a full-time author and illustrator of children's
books. She has written two novels and has illustrated fiction and
greeting cards, as well as maze, adventure, and puzzle books that
have been published all over the world. She lives in Australia.
"Young readers will be enchanted by these playful mice and will
thoroughly enjoy this fun book that helps with understanding
addition."—School Library Journal
"Mixed-media illustrations of cute-as-can-be acrobatic mice are
supported by a spare text and a simple equation on each spread,
providing an inviting way to introduce basic addition."—The Horn
Book
"Ten mice demonstrate the combinations of numbers that can add up
to 10 in this cozy picture book . . . It's a clear and focused
exploration of the concept, one that doesn't lack for fun thanks to
the mice's antics."—Publishers Weekly
"The text works well, setting up the book's structure, while the
high-spirited pencil, liquid acrylic, and collage illustrations
give it a joyful look and offer plenty of amusing details for kids
to discover on their own. A playful introduction to counting,
sorting, and sets."—Booklist
